Hybrid Computer Explain.  — a hybrid computer is a combined complex of several electronic computer units built using the different characterization of quantities (i.e., analog and digital features) and united by a single control system.  — a hybrid computer is a type of computer that offers the functionalities of both a digital and an analog computer.
